Island Estates sits in Palm Coast, in Flagler County, and like most of this coastal market the price here is driven by the home itself rather than any single formula. Condition, positioning, and whether a property backs to water or a preserve tend to move value more than square footage alone, and the spread between a dated home and an updated one can be wide.
With only a short recent closings window to read from, treat comps as directional, not gospel. Buyers should underwrite each listing on its own merits and be ready to move on the right one; sellers should price to condition and lean on presentation, because in a thin-data corridor the outliers are usually explained by the house, not the neighborhood.

The market around Island Estates
Island Estates is a small community — 27 recorded sales on file, most recently in 2026 — too few for its own price trend. Here is the market around it.
In ZIP 32137, 705 homes are on the market and 23% are under contract — a steady corner of Palm Coast.
Across Flagler County, 1,268 homes are active and 370 pending (23% under contract).
Homes here are single family residence.
ZIP and county figures describe the wider market, not Island Estates specifically. Momentum Research analysis of MLS records.
The Island Estates buying strategy.
If we were buying in Island Estates today, this is the order of operations we would run for our clients.
Underwrite the condition first. Price the roof, HVAC, and systems honestly before judging any list price; condition swings value here more than square footage alone.
Match the home to real comps. Recent sales of similar condition and lot, not the asking price, tell you what a home is worth.
Move deliberately, not desperately. Neither side has a decisive edge, so a well-prepared, fairly-priced offer wins without overpaying.
Line up financing and inspection early. A pre-approval and an inspection plan let you act fast and negotiate from evidence.

Reading a thin-data market
The challenge in a community this size is sample size. A two-closing window gives you a pulse, not a trend, so a single well-renovated or waterfront sale can distort what looks like the going rate. The discipline here is to weigh each home against its own condition, view, and lot before anchoring to any recent number.
That works in a prepared buyer's favor. When there are few active comparables, the party who has walked the inventory and understands what drives premiums — waterfront or preserve frontage, updates, and true usable space — negotiates from knowledge rather than headline figures. The same holds for sellers, who need pricing built from the specific asset up.
The location and the amenities are priced into every listing in Island Estates. The deal is won or lost on condition, the comps, and the renovation math.
